网页表格不能复制怎么办:专业解决方案与技巧
在日常的网络浏览和数据处理中,我们时常会遇到网页表格无法直接复制的情况,这不仅影响了工作效率,还可能造成数据处理的困扰
本文将详细探讨网页表格无法复制的原因,并提供一系列专业、高效的解决方案与技巧,帮助用户轻松应对这一问题
一、网页表格无法复制的原因
1. 格式不兼容
网页表格可能采用特定的HTML代码结构或CSS样式,这些在不同的浏览器或数据处理软件中可能无法完全兼容
例如,某些复杂的表格格式在复制到Excel时可能会丢失部分样式或数据
2. 版权保护
部分网站为了防止数据被非法复制和传播,会对网页内容设置版权保护
这种情况下,直接复制表格可能会受到限制
3. 特殊字符或格式
表格中可能包含特殊字符、公式或脚本,这些在复制到不支持这些元素的软件时可能无法正确显示或处理
4. 技术限制
网站开发者可能通过JavaScript等技术手段限制用户复制网页内容,以保护网站数据的安全性和完整性
二、解决方案与技巧
1. 使用网页源代码复制
当网页表格无法直接复制时,可以通过查看并复制网页的源代码来实现
具体操作步骤如下:
1. 右键点击网页空白处:在弹出的菜单中选择“查看页面源代码”或使用快捷键(如Ctrl+U)
2. 查找表格HTML代码:在源代码中搜索
标签,找到对应的表格HTML代码
3. 复制并粘贴:将找到的表格HTML代码复制到文本编辑器(如Notepad++)中,并保存为.html文件
使用浏览器打开该HTML文件,即可在浏览器中查看并复制表格内容
2. 导出为其他格式
如果网页提供了导出功能,可以直接将表格导出为CSV、Excel等可编辑格式
这种方法简单快捷,且能够保持数据的完整性和准确性
3. 使用屏幕截图与OCR技术
对于无法直接复制且没有导出选项的表格,可以使用屏幕截图工具(如Snagit、Nimbus Screenshot)将表格截取下来,然后使用OCR(光学字符识别)软件(如ABBYY FineReader、Tesseract)将图片中的文字识别出来,转换成可编辑的文本
4. 借助第三方工具
市面上有许多第三方工具和服务可以帮助用户复制网页表格,如Nimbus Capture、Table Capture等
这些工具通常提供了更为便捷的操作界面和强大的功能,能够自动识别并提取网页中的表格数据
5. 编程方法
对于有一定编程基础的用户,可以通过编写脚本来抓取网页表格数据
例如,使用Python的requests库和BeautifulSoup库可以方便地抓取网页内容,并使用pandas库将表格数据解析为DataFrame对象,进而进行数据处理和分析
三、注意事项
- 在复制网页表格时,应尊重网站的版权规定,避免未经授权的数据复制和传播
- 使用第三方工具和服务时,应注意安全性和稳定性,避免泄露个人信息或数据
- 对于复杂或敏感的数据处理任务,建议使用专业的数据处理软件或工具,以确保数据的准确性和安全性
综上所述,网页表格无法复制的问题可以通过多种方法解决
用户可以根据实际情况选择合适的方法,以提高数据处理效率和工作质量
同时,也应注意遵守相关法律法规和道德规范,尊重网站版权和数据安全